David Crow - Healing & Environment PDF Print E-mail
David Crow

David Crow earned his initial accreditation from the American College of Traditional Chinese Medicine in 1984, and after several years of clinical herbology and acupuncture practice in the US journeyed to Nepal to study Ayurvedic and Tibetan medicine with traditional doctors in Kathmandu. His book In Search of the Medicine Buddha documents the story of these internships and his awakening to the environmental destruction imperiling the medicinal plants on which these ancient medical systems depend.

Through writing, teaching, and activism, David promotes grassroots healthcare systems based on community herbal gardens, such as The Learning Garden in Los Angeles, which he co-founded and helped develop into one of America's largest and most successful school gardening experiments.

He also founded the aromatic essence firm Floracopeia as an international fair trade enterprise and educational knowledge base to help promote botanical medicines as solutions to the interrelated global problems of poverty, healthcare scarcity, environmental destruction, and loss of ethnobotanical knowledge.

David is also an experienced teacher of Vipassana meditation , which he uses to awaken students to the essential biological unity of the body and the ecological surround. He will be helping USW develop Chautauqua-like performing arts & aromatic education tours, organic medicinal farming curricula, and herbal essence production skills.
